DescriptionKing on the Throne is one of the smaller formations in the City of Rocks. Mostly gear protected routes, very few bolts exist on this formation. Good rock, fun routes and zero approach make it a worthwhile destination. Getting ThereLocated across the street from the Parking Lot Rock road and next to campsite #64. The ClassicsMountain Project's determination of some of the classic, most popular, highest rated routes for King on The Throne:
Snakes and Ladders 5.9- Trad, 1 pitch, 50 feet
Z-Cracks 5.9 Trad, 1 pitch, 50 feet
Double Cracks 5.10a Trad, 1 pitch, 70 feet
The Awakening 5.11a Trad, Sport, 1 pitch, 65 feet

Double Cracks 5.10a ID : City of Rocks : King on The Throne
Double Cracks is located on the north end of the formation. It starts off with two parallel, strenuous, steep and slippery finger cracks. After this the angle eases and some stemming and jamming with a hand hold thrown in here and there gets one to the top....[more] Browse More Classics in ID |
